Subject: Inventory write-down — heads up

Team,

Quick note before Thursday's session: we're taking a write-down on the legacy Pellbright cartridge stock — roughly 8% of carried inventory, mostly units superseded by the new line. It'll dent Q3 margins but clears the warehouse and the books. Finance has the detailed schedule ready. There's a confidential note on where this fits strategically just below.

confidential, kagup-bafog: Fraaxax Group is in early talks to buy Soroxox Group for about $343.8 million. The Olidor launch date is June 14, and nothing goes to the press before then. Legal wants the Aldmirek Logistics term sheet signed before July 23.

**Step 4: Enable the consent banner**

The Larchfen consent banner is gated per region and logs acceptance events to the audit sink before any trackers load. Rollout proceeds in three cohorts; no cohort receives trackers until banner acceptance is recorded. The gating and logging behavior are driven by the settings shown below.

service settings:
PRAWYN_PIN=9848
PRAWYN_METRICS_HOST=metrics.prawyn.lumicworks.corp
PRAWYN_LOG_LEVEL=warn
PRAWYN_TENANT=pelius

The consent banner rollout for Veldrome 3.1 is gated behind the `cb_phase` flag served by the Gatewick config service. Phases advance in order: `shadow`, `partial`, `full`. Rollback is immediate on flag reset; no cache purge needed. Banner copy variants are fetched at render time, so translations update without a deploy. Release managers should confirm `full` only after the Orvane metrics dashboard shows dismiss rates below 2%. Queries to Gatewick's admin endpoint require the staging key that follows.

service key, tadup-tahog: zpat7_wB1tnEL

TURN-208: Gatevale turnstile counters at the Merrow Field pilot double-count when a rotation reverses mid-cycle. Attendance totals drift roughly 2% high per event. The debounce window fix is implemented, reviewed by Ilsa, and soak-tested across two simulated match days without drift. Ready for your cut; the candidate build is identified below.

trace token, tagag-tafog: htk6_5ed18c